From: Jim Pryor Date: Sat, 16 Oct 2010 18:14:48 +0000 (-0400) Subject: alternate Y1,Y2 tweak X-Git-Url: http://lambda.jimpryor.net/git/gitweb.cgi?p=lambda.git;a=commitdiff_plain;h=f4c96076c1abbdf13bfb90d7e5b56ebe80dd7de7 alternate Y1,Y2 tweak Signed-off-by: Jim Pryor --- diff --git a/hints/assignment_4_hint_3_alternate_1.mdwn b/hints/assignment_4_hint_3_alternate_1.mdwn index dd55e052..900c6cb1 100644 --- a/hints/assignment_4_hint_3_alternate_1.mdwn +++ b/hints/assignment_4_hint_3_alternate_1.mdwn @@ -13,11 +13,13 @@ Alternate strategy for Y1, Y2 let rec u g x = (let f = u g in A) in let rec g y = (let f = u g in B) - in let f = u g in C + in let f = u g in + C or, expanded into the form we've been working with: let u = Y (\u g x. (\f. A) (u g)) in let g = Y (\g y. (\f. B) (u g)) in - let f = u g + let f = u g in + C